...modes of visual communication, in particular images, symbols and written words. Graffiti can be used as form of territorial marking, personal branding, flirting, grieving, declaring love, expressing discontent or of showing support for or membership of a particular political group, football team, style of music or music subculture (most notably hip hop) and much more....

Integrated care broadly means the capacity for different parts of an organisation (departments or staff groups) to work together to offer good quality care.
